@charset "utf-8";


@media( min-width:1000px){
/**banner**/
#banner{ display:inherit;}
#mySwipe{ display:none;}
#banner{ background:#f1f1f1; overflow:hidden; width:100%; height:783px;}
#index_banner{width:100%;height:783px;overflow:hidden;position:relative; margin-top:0px;}
#index_banner_list{width:100%;height:783px;}
#index_banner_list li{width:100%;height:783px;display:none;}
#index_banner_list li a{display:block;width:100%;height:783px;padding:0;text-indent:-9999px;background:url() no-repeat top center;}
#prev_btn, #next_btn {	width: 40px;	height: 61px;	display: block;	position: absolute;	top: 380px;	display: none;}
#prev_btn {	left: 50px;}
#next_btn {	right: 50px;}
#index_banner_nav{width:100%;position:absolute;top:760px;left:0;text-align:center;}
#index_banner_nav a{display:inline-block;width:12px;height:12px;margin-right:6px; border-radius:20px;background:#fff;font-size:0; color:#fff;}
#index_banner_nav a.this{background:#008544; color:#008544;}
/**-------------**/

#top{ background:url(image/topdi.jpg) center top; height:37px; width:100%; overflow:hidden;}
#top .a{ width:1024px; margin:0 auto; overflow:hidden; color:#fff; font-size:16px; line-height:37px;}

#top1{ background:rgba(255,255,255,0.6); width:100%; position:absolute; height:116px; z-index:20;}
#top1 .a{ width:1024px; margin:0 auto;}
#top1 .a .logo{ float:left; padding-top:21px;}
#top1 .a .logo p{ display:none;}
#top1 .a .menu{ float:right; margin-top:-37px;}
#top1 .a .menu dl{ list-style:none;}
#top1 .a .menu dl dd{ float:left;}
#top1 .a .menu dl dd a{ display:block; padding:116px 24px 0 24px; color:#fff; font-size:15px; font-weight:bold; line-height:37px;}
#top1 .a .menu dl dd a.it{ color:#333;}
#top1 .a .menu dl dd.d2 a{ background:url(image/a1.png)}
#top1 .a .menu dl dd.d3 a{ background:url(image/a2.png)}
#top1 .a .menu dl dd.d4 a{ background:url(image/a3.png)}
#top1 .a .menu dl dd.d5 a{ background:url(image/a4.png)}
#top1 .a .menu dl dd.d6 a{ background:url(image/a5.png)}

#top1 .a .menu dl dd .zmenu{ position:absolute; display:none;}
#top1 .a .menu dl dd .zmenu ul{ list-style:none;}
#top1 .a .menu dl dd .zmenu ul li a{ padding:0 24px; font-weight:normal;}
#top1 .a .menu dl dd .zmenu ul li a:hover{ text-decoration:underline;}

#top1 .a .menu dl dt{ float:left; margin-left:30px;}
#top1 .a .menu dl dt a{ display:block; color:#fff; background:url(image/bit1.png) 50px no-repeat; line-height:37px; text-align:center; width:60px;}
#top1 .a .menu dl dt .lan{ position:absolute; background:#FF9F00; display:none;}
#top1 .a .menu dl dt .lan ul{ list-style:none;}
#top1 .a .menu dl dt .lan ul li a{ background:none; line-height:30px;}

.index_tt{ width:1024px; margin:0 auto; overflow:hidden; background:url(image/line.jpg) center repeat-x; text-align:center; margin-top:95px;}
.index_tt span{ background:#fff; padding:0 30px; font-size:38px; font-family:"华文楷体"; line-height:50px; color:#333;}



#index_pro{ width:1024px; margin:0 auto; overflow:hidden;}
#index_pro ul{ list-style:none; width:1100px;}
#index_pro ul li{ float:left; margin-right:17px; text-align:center; width:330px;}
#index_pro ul li p.a{ font-size:30px; color:#000; line-height:50px;}
#index_pro ul li p.b{ font-size:14px; line-height:50px; color:#333;}
#index_pro ul li p.c img{ width:100%;}
#index_pro ul li p.over{ display:none; background:rgba(51,51,51,0.8); margin-top:-467px; z-index:20; width:330px; padding-top:80px; height:387px; position:absolute; text-align:center;}
#index_pro ul li p.over a{ color:#fff; line-height:70px; display:block; font-size:16px; transition:font 0.5s,color 0.5s;}
#index_pro ul li p.over a:hover{ color:#49C2EF;font-size:20px;}

#index_news{ width:1024px; overflow:hidden; box-shadow:0px 0px 20px #ccc; margin:30px auto 120px auto;}
#index_news ul{ list-style:none;}
#index_news ul li{ width:256px; float:left;}
#index_news ul li a{ display:block;}
#index_news ul li a img{ width:100%;}
#index_news ul li a p{ padding:0 20px; border-left:solid 1px #E9E9E9; border-right:solid 1px #E9E9E9;}
#index_news ul li a p.a1{ font-size:26px; line-height:70px; padding-top:20px; color:#444;}
#index_news ul li a p.a2{ font-size:16px; line-height:25px; color:#666;}
#index_news ul li a p.a3{ font-size:14px; line-height:24px; color:#666; padding-top:20px;}
#index_news ul li a p.a4{ font-size:16px; line-height:24px; color:#DB7566; padding-top:20px; padding-bottom:30px; border-bottom:solid 1px #E9E9E9;}
#index_news ul li a:hover p.a4{ color:#49C2EF;}

#weather{ background:#1782EA; width:100%; overflow:hidden; height:238px; text-align:center;}

#bottom{ background:url(image/bottom.jpg) center; height:553px; overflow:hidden;}

#website{ width:1024px; margin:0 auto; overflow:hidden;}
#website ul{ list-style:none}
#website ul li{ width:341px; text-align:center; float:left; padding-top:100px;}
#website ul li a{ color:#fff; line-height:30px; font-size:14px;}
#website ul li p.a{ padding-top:20px;}
#website ul li p.a a{ font-size:24px; line-height:70px;}
#website ul li p a:hover{ text-decoration:underline;}

.bottom_hline{ background:url(image/hline.png) right bottom no-repeat,url(image/hline.png) left bottom no-repeat;}


#copyright{ width:1024px; margin:50px auto 0 auto; padding-top:25px; overflow:hidden; border-top:solid 1px rgba(255,255,255,0.5); color:#fff;}
#copyright span{ float:right;}
#copyright a{ color:#fff;}
#copyright a:hover{ text-decoration:underline;}

#about_banner{ background:url(image/aboutpic.jpg) center top; height:500px; width:100%; overflow:hidden;}

#about_menu{ width:100%; overflow:hidden; background:#1782EA;}
#about_menu ul{ list-style:none; width:1024px; margin:0 auto; overflow:hidden;}
#about_menu ul li{ float:left; width:33.33%;}
#about_menu ul li a{ display:block; line-height:50px; text-align:center; color:#fff; transition:background 0.5s;}
#about_menu ul li a.a1{ background:#AA8DC3;}
#about_menu ul li a.a2{ background:#6BA2DB;}
#about_menu ul li a.a3{ background:#4ED0F2;}
#about_menu ul li a.a1:hover{ background:#9156C4}
#about_menu ul li a.a2:hover{ background:#3887DA}
#about_menu ul li a.a3:hover{ background:#31B0D1}

.title{ font-size:30px; line-height:40px; width:1024px; margin:0 auto; overflow:hidden; text-align:center; color:#000; font-family:"华文楷体"; padding-top:50px;}
.title p{ font-size:12px; color:#999; line-height:14px; background:url(image/line.jpg) center repeat-x; font-family:"微软雅黑";}
.title p span{ background:#fff; padding:0 20px;}

#about{ width:1024px; margin:30px auto 50px auto; overflow:hidden;}
#about img{ width:100%;}

#top_title{ width:1024px; margin:0 auto; overflow:hidden; text-align:left;}
#top_title p{ width:270px; height:65px; position:absolute; margin-top:-40px; z-index:80; background:#1580D9; padding:5px 7px;}
#top_title p span{ display:block; border:solid 1px #fff; color:#fff; line-height:63px; font-size:40px; text-indent:24px;}

#position{ width:1024px; font-size:18px; margin:0 auto; overflow:hidden; line-height:70px; border-bottom:solid 1px #aaa; color:#333; padding-top:35px;}
#position a{ color:#666; font-size:18px;}
#position a:hover{ color:#000;}

.food_tt{ width:1024px; margin:0 auto; overflow:hidden; background:url(image/line1.jpg) center repeat-x; text-align:center; margin-top:70px;}
.food_tt span{ background:#fff; padding:0 30px; font-size:32px; font-family:"华文楷体"; line-height:50px; color:#333;}

.food_con{ width:1024px; margin:0 auto; overflow:hidden; padding-top:40px;}
.food_left{ float:left; width:500px; overflow:hidden;}
.food_left p.a1{ width:100%; overflow:hidden; height:313px; cursor:pointer;}
.food_left p.a1 img{ width:100%}
.food_left p.a2{ font-size:16px; color:#000; line-height:90px;}
.food_left p.a3{ font-size:13px; color:#000; line-height:24px;}
.food_left p.a4{ font-size:13px; color:#000; line-height:26px; padding-top:10px;}
.food_left p.a5{ font-size:13px; color:#000; line-height:26px;}
.food_left p.a6{ float:right; margin-top:-40px;}
.food_left p.a6 a{ display:block; font-size:14px; line-height:40px; color:#000; border-bottom:solid 2px #333; transition:border 0.5s;}
.food_left p.a6 a:hover{border-bottom:solid 2px #d00;}

.food_right{ float:right; overflow:hidden; width:500px;}
.food_right ul{ list-style:none; width:530px;}
.food_right ul li{ float:left;  width:220px; margin-right:20px;}
.food_right ul li a{ display:block; line-height:55px; color:#000; font-size:20px;}
.food_right ul li a img{ width:100%;}
.food_right ul li a p.bm{ width:220px; height:179px; overflow:hidden;}

#di_h{width:100%; overflow:hidden; height:80px;}

#water{ width:100%; background:url(image/water.jpg) center top no-repeat; height:4176px; overflow:hidden;}

#water_con{ width:500px; margin:0 auto; }
.a_layer{ background:url(water/di.png); width:588px; height:392px; overflow:hidden; position:absolute; z-index:50;}
.a_layer img{ margin:26px 0 0 26px;}
#p1{ margin:1950px 0 0 -100px; display:none;}
#p2{ margin:1950px 0 0 350px; display:none;}
#p3{ margin:1550px 0 0 350px; display:none;}
#p4{ margin:2500px 0 0 -100px; display:none;}
#p5{ margin:1550px 0 0 -150px;display:none;}
#p6{ margin:2400px 0 0 350px; display:none;}
.b_btn{ cursor:pointer;width:340px; height:260px; overflow:hidden; position:absolute; z-index:50;}
#btn1{ margin:2280px 0 0 -110px;}
#btn2{ margin:2270px 0 0 350px; }
#btn3{ margin:1900px 0 0 300px;}
#btn4{ margin:2850px 0 0 -100px; }
#btn5{ margin:1900px 0 0 -150px;}
#btn6{ margin:2720px 0 0 350px;}

#yangsheng{ width:100%; background:url(image/yangsheng.jpg) center top no-repeat; height:6360px; overflow:hidden;}

#yangsheng_con{ width:500px; margin:0 auto; }
.y_layer{ background:url(water/di.png); width:588px; height:392px; overflow:hidden; position:absolute; z-index:50;}
.y_layer img{ margin:26px 0 0 26px;}
#yp1{ margin:5350px 0 0 -100px; display:none;}
#yp2{ margin:1350px 0 0 0px; display:none;}
#yp3{ margin:1250px 0 0 350px; display:none;}
#yp4{ margin:2200px 0 0 300px; display:none;}
#yp5{ margin:3450px 0 0 300px;display:none;}
#yp6{ margin:3300px 0 0 -300px; display:none;}
#yp7{ margin:1600px 0 0 300px; display:none;}
#yp8{ margin:4300px 0 0 350px; display:none;}
#yp9{ margin:4600px 0 0 -300px; display:none;}
#yp10{ margin:4800px 0 0 350px; display:none;}
.y_btn{ cursor:pointer;width:340px; height:260px; overflow:hidden; position:absolute; z-index:50;}
#ybtn1{ margin:5580px 0 0 -110px;width:440px; height:360px;}
#ybtn2{ margin:1570px 0 0 0px; }
#ybtn3{ margin:1600px 0 0 500px;}
#ybtn4{ margin:2550px 0 0 200px;}
#ybtn5{ margin:3800px 0 0 300px;}
#ybtn6{ margin:3620px 0 0 -300px;}
#ybtn7{ margin:1920px 0 0 300px;}
#ybtn8{ margin:4620px 0 0 350px;}
#ybtn9{ margin:4920px 0 0 -300px;}
#ybtn10{ margin:5120px 0 0 350px;}


#wuzhou{ width:100%; background:url(image/wuzhou.jpg) center top no-repeat; height:6054px; overflow:hidden;}

#wuzhou_con{ width:500px; margin:0 auto; }
.w_layer{ background:url(water/di.png); width:588px; height:392px; overflow:hidden; position:absolute; z-index:50;}
.w_layer img{ margin:26px 0 0 26px;}
#wp1{ margin:4750px 0 0 350px; display:none;}
#wp2{ margin:4550px 0 0 -110px; display:none;}
#wp3{ margin:4500px 0 0 240px; display:none;}
#wp4{ margin:3450px 0 0 -300px; display:none;}
#wp5{ margin:3400px 0 0 350px;display:none;}
#wp6{ margin:3780px 0 0 270px; display:none;}
#wp7{ margin:4000px 0 0 -150px; display:none;}
#wp8{ margin:3380px 0 0 80px; display:none;}
#wp9{ margin:1500px 0 0 -310px; display:none;}
#wp10{ margin:2450px 0 0 -90px; display:none;}
#wp11{ margin:2410px 0 0 350px; display:none;}
#wp12{ margin:4150px 0 0 350px; display:none;}
#wp13{ margin:1900px 0 0 -110px; display:none;}
#wp14{ margin:1900px 0 0 350px; display:none;}
#wp15{ margin:1550px 0 0 320px; display:none;}
.w_btn{ cursor:pointer;width:340px; height:260px; overflow:hidden; position:absolute; z-index:50; border-radius:800px;}
#wbtn1{ margin:5060px 0 0 480px;width:330px; height:330px;}
#wbtn2{ margin:4926px 0 0 -160px; width:330px; height:330px;}
#wbtn3{ margin:4883px 0 0 240px;width:240px; height:240px;}
#wbtn4{ margin:3847px 0 0 -300px;width:240px; height:240px;}
#wbtn5{ margin:3700px 0 0 520px;width:240px; height:240px;}
#wbtn6{ margin:4093px 0 0 270px;width:240px; height:240px;}
#wbtn7{ margin:4360px 0 0 -150px;width:240px; height:240px;}
#wbtn8{ margin:3700px 0 0 80px;width:240px; height:240px;}
#wbtn9{ margin:1880px 0 0 -290px;width:140px; height:140px;}
#wbtn10{ margin:2790px 0 0 -90px;width:240px; height:240px;}
#wbtn11{ margin:2740px 0 0 450px;width:240px; height:240px;}
#wbtn12{ margin:4500px 0 0 350px;width:240px; height:240px;}
#wbtn13{ margin:2240px 0 0 -110px;width:240px; height:240px;}
#wbtn14{ margin:2200px 0 0 350px;width:240px; height:240px;}
#wbtn15{ margin:1880px 0 0 320px;width:140px; height:140px;}

#news{ width:1200px; margin:0 auto; overflow:hidden;}

#newsli{ width:900px; float:left; overflow:hidden;}
#newsli ul{ list-style:none;}
#newsli ul li{ border-bottom:solid 1px #eee; padding-bottom:20px; overflow:hidden; padding-top:20px;}
#newsli ul li a{ display:block;}
#newsli ul li a p.a0{ float:left;  width:200px; height:150px; overflow:hidden; margin-right:20px;}
#newsli ul li a p.a0 img{width:100%;}
#newsli ul li a div{overflow:hidden;}
#newsli ul li a div p.a1{ font-size:18px; color:#000; line-height:40px; padding-bottom:10px;}
#newsli ul li a div p.a2{ font-size:14px; line-height:18px; color:#333;}
#newsli ul li a div p.a3{ font-size:12px; color:#666; padding-top:30px;}

#newsdate{ width:200px; overflow:hidden; float:right; padding-top:20px;}
#newsdate dl{ list-style:none;}
#newsdate dl dt{ line-height:40px; font-size:18px; color:#000;}
#newsdate dl dd a{ display:block; color:#333; line-height:40px; font-size:14px;background:url(image/line2.jpg) left bottom no-repeat;background-size:0px 2px; transition:background 0.5s;}
#newsdate dl dd a:hover{ background:url(image/line2.jpg) left bottom no-repeat; background-size:100px 2px;}
#newsdate dl dd a.it{ background:url(image/line2.jpg) left bottom no-repeat; background-size:100px 2px;}

#page{ width:100%; overflow:hidden; padding-top:30px;}
#page ul{ list-style:none;}
#page ul li{ float:left; margin-right:10px;}
#page ul li a{ display:block; padding:0 15px; font-size:14px; line-height:40px; border:solid 1px #eee; transition:background 0.5s,color 0.5s;}
#page ul li a:hover{ background:#1580D9; color:#fff;}
#page ul li a.it{ background:#1580D9; color:#fff;}

#detail{ width:1200px; margin:0 auto; overflow:hidden;}
#detail p.a1{ font-size:24px; line-height:30px; color:#000; padding:30px 0;}
#detail p.a2{ font-size:14px; line-height:30px;}
#detail .a3{ padding-bottom:30px; overflow:hidden;}

#faq{ width:1024px; margin:30px auto 50px auto; overflow:hidden;}
#faq ul{ list-style:none;}
#faq ul li{ border-bottom:solid 1px #eee; padding-bottom:20px; padding-top:20px;}
#faq ul li div.wen{ overflow:hidden;}
#faq ul li div.wen span{ display:block; float:left; width:40px; height:40px; line-height:40px; background:#1782ea; border-radius:50px; text-align:center; color:#fff; margin-right:30px;}
#faq ul li div.wen p{ line-height:40px; color:#000; font-size:18px;}
#faq ul li div.da{ overflow:hidden; padding-top:10px;}
#faq ul li div.da span{ display:block; float:left; width:40px; height:40px; line-height:40px; background:#1aa500; border-radius:50px; text-align:center; color:#fff; margin-right:30px;}
#faq ul li div.da p{ line-height:24px; color:#666; font-size:14px; overflow:hidden;}

#mykuang{ width:1024px; margin:0 auto; padding-bottom:80px; overflow:hidden;}

#right{ right:0; position:fixed; z-index:100;}
#right ul{ list-style:none;}
#right ul li{ padding-bottom:1px;}
#right ul li a{ display:block;}


#map{ width:100%; overflow:hidden; overflow:hidden;}
#map img{ width:100%;}

.map0{position:absolute; z-index:500; display:none;}
#map1{}
#map2{}
#map3{}
#map4{}
#map5{}
#map6{}
#map7{}
#map8{}
#map9{}
#map10{}
#map11{}
#map12{}
#map13{}
#map14{}
#map15{}
#map16{}
#map17{}

.click{display:block; width:100px; height:50px; position:absolute; z-index:500; cursor:pointer;}
#click1{}
#click2{}
#click3{}
#click4{}
#click5{}
#click6{}
#click7{}
#click8{}
#click9{}
#click10{}
#click11{}
#click12{}
#click13{}
#click14{}
#click15{}
#click16{}
#click17{}

}

